India, April 17 -- Delhi power minister Ashish Sood on Wednesday took stock of a recently installed battery energy storage system (Bess) set up in Kilokari, south Delhi, which will aid in providing power supply during outages and bridge the demand gap in peak summer, officials familiar with the development said.

Describing the facility as the country's "first commercially approved standalone" facility, Sood said it would improve supply to around 100,000 domestic consumers and reduce network overloading.
